What Are LED Display Panels?
LED stands for Light Emitting Diode, a technology that allows for the creation of bright and energy-efficient displays. These panels consist of numerous tiny LEDs that work together to produce images and videos. Unlike traditional display methods, LED panels can be configured in various sizes and shapes, making them adaptable to different exhibition spaces. Evaluating the Quality of Used Panels
When considering used LED display panels, it is crucial to evaluate their condition carefully. Look for any signs of wear and tear, such as scratches or fading, which could affect the display quality. It is also advisable to test the panels before purchasing to ensure they function correctly and meet the desired specifications. A thorough inspection can save you from unexpected issues down the line, ensuring that your investment is sound.
Inquire about the history of the panels, including how frequently they were used and the type of environments they were exposed to. Understanding their previous usage can provide insight into their longevity and reliability. Additionally, ask about any maintenance or repairs that have been performed on the panels; well-maintained equipment can often perform as well as new. It may also be beneficial to seek out panels from reputable sellers who can provide warranties or return policies, offering peace of mind with your purchase. Maintenance of LED Display Panels
Maintaining LED display panels is crucial for ensuring their longevity and performance. Regular upkeep can prevent potential issues and keep the displays looking their best throughout the exhibition.
Cleaning and Care
Cleaning LED panels should be done with care to avoid damaging the display. Using a soft, lint-free cloth and a gentle cleaning solution can help remove dust and smudges without scratching the surface. It is essential to follow the manufacturer’s guidelines for cleaning to ensure the panels remain in optimal condition.
Additionally, keeping the panels in a controlled environment can help prevent overheating and other issues. Avoid exposing them to extreme temperatures or humidity, as these conditions can affect their performance.
Regular Testing and Updates
Before each exhibition, it is advisable to test the LED display panels to ensure they are functioning correctly. This includes checking for any dead pixels, ensuring the brightness levels are appropriate, and confirming that the content is displaying as intended.
Updating the content regularly can also keep the display fresh and engaging. This is particularly important for artists who may want to showcase new works or change the focus of their presentation throughout the duration of the event.
